Post: Collect rent with Venmo?

RJ DixonPosted
  • Rental Property Investor
  • Sarasota, FL
  • Posts 112
  • Votes 23

@DJ Daller

I use the option approach. I give them 3 Choices Venmo, cash app or PayPal. I have yet to use cozy but I think that can collect rent for you as well. I tell them the benefit using these apps is you can use a credit card if you know your rent will be late ! Better then paying the late fees !
